Abstract
The present invention relates to a kind of marine air fixed system, including a mounting bracket;One fixed cell, fixed cell is located in mounting bracket, including a pair of lower support bases being connected with lower mounting bracket and a pair of upper limit seats being connected with upper mounting bracket, and lower support base mutually corresponds with upper limit seat, the upper end of the lower support base is respectively provided with an arc groove with the lower end of upper limit seat, an elevating mechanism is provided between upper limit seat and mounting bracket, it is lower that a sliding equipment is provided between support base and mounting bracket;One locking unit, locking unit include the tie down screw being threadedly coupled respectively with lower support base, upper limit seat, and tie down screw holds out against air bottle.The advantage of the invention is that:The installation of air bottle is realized by the common cooperation between lower support base and upper limit seat, so as to which the upper and lower ends of air bottle can be reached with fixed limit effect well, then holding out against for screw rod is locked, realizes the fixation of air bottle well.

Background technology
Need that many individual air bottles are installed on cabin, and current air bottle is normally mounted at outside cabin, therefore hold
Easily cause air bottle and connecting tube hit, and air bottle and connecting tube easily caused after being hit gas leakage and it is quick-fried
Fried and burning, so as to cause a serious accident, in view of disadvantages described above, is necessary to design a kind of marine air fixed system in fact.
Therefore, for above-mentioned phenomenon, a kind of marine air protection device is just refer in patent CN205226884U,
Including chassis, the first mounting seat, the second mounting seat, the first tie down screw, the second tie down screw, support bar, upper framework, this is peculiar to vessel
Air bottle fixed system, the cuboid framework being welded to form by chassis, support bar and upper framework, and the cuboid framework can be right
Air bottle plays a protective role, and avoids air bottle from being hit, and can be by the first mounting seat and the second mounting seat to air
Bottle is played a supporting role, while plays fixation to air bottle by the first tie down screw and the second tie down screw, prevents ship
Wave in the running of cabin and cause air bottle to hit, the apparatus structure is simple, powerful, and air bottle and connecting tube can be risen
To protective action, air bottle and connecting tube is avoided to be caused to leak by external force collision or explode.
In said mechanism, when air bottle is fixed, what is passed through is the first mounting seat and the second mounting seat of lower end
The fixation of air bottle is realized in the locking of the first tie down screw and the second tie down screw of support and side to air bottle.
Using such fixed form, do not blocked above air bottle, and between air bottle and mounting seat and tie down screw simultaneously
Without any direct annexation, therefore, when ship shakes, air bottle very likely departs from from mounting seat, protection
Effect is bad.
The content of the invention
The technical problem to be solved in the present invention is to provide a kind of good marine air fixed system of protecting effect.
In order to solve the above technical problems, the technical scheme is that:A kind of marine air fixed system, its innovative point
It is:The fixed system is used to carry out the air bottle on ship installation protection, including
One mounting bracket, the mounting bracket are a cuboid framework structure;
One fixed cell, the fixed cell are located in mounting bracket, including a pair of lower supports for being arranged on mounting bracket lower end
Seat and a pair of upper limit seats for being arranged on mounting bracket upper end, and lower support base mutually corresponds with upper limit seat, the lower branch
Support the upper end of seat and be respectively provided with an arc groove with the lower end of upper limit seat, and lower support base is collectively forming appearance air with upper limit seat
The cavity that bottle is placed, is provided with an elevating mechanism between the upper limit seat and mounting bracket, lower support base and mounting bracket it
Between be provided with a sliding equipment;
One locking unit, the locking unit include the lock for corresponding and being threadedly coupled with lower support base, upper limit seat respectively
Tight screw rod, and tie down screw holds out against air bottle through its front end after lower support base or upper limit seat.
Further, the lower support base in the arc groove of upper limit seat with being additionally provided with protection rubber cushion.
Further, the tie down screw holds out against one end of air bottle and is also set with protection gum cover.
Further, the elevating mechanism is:The top of two upper limit seats is arranged on a lifter plate, in mounting bracket
The both sides of upper end there is the driving cylinder that moves back and forth up and down of driving lifter plate respectively.
Further, the sliding equipment is:There are pair of sliding guide rail, two lower support bases in the lower end of mounting bracket
Bottom be arranged on a linkage board, there is the sliding block that is engaged with rail plate, the rail plate in the bottom of linkage board
One end there is one end of a pair of sliding blocks to carry out spacing baffle plate, the other end that the other end has a pair of sliding blocks carries out spacing limit
Position nut, while there is the screwed hole coordinated with stop nut screw thread on rail plate.
The advantage of the invention is that:In the present invention, by the common cooperation between lower support base and upper limit seat come real
The installation of existing air bottle, so as to which the upper and lower ends of air bottle can be reached with fixed limit effect well, then lock spiral shell
Bar is held out against, and realizes the fixation of air bottle well.
In addition, in order to coordinate the upper limit seat set up, a sliding equipment is set up between lower support base and mounting bracket,
When placing air bottle, first lower support base integrally can be pulled out, after air bottle is positioned on lower support base, then by lower support base
Original position is delivered to, causes to collide between upper limit seat, lower support base during air bottle is placed so as to avoid, effectively
Protect air bottle;And by coordinating between baffle plate and stop nut, so as to the phase between lower support base and mounting bracket
It is spacing to position progress, avoid it from shifting.
One elevating mechanism is set between upper limit seat and mounting bracket, it is first using elevating mechanism when placing air bottle
Upper limit seat is lifted, so as to increase the gap between upper limit seat and lower support base, avoids what is resetted in lower support base
During cause to collide between air bottle and upper limit seat, facilitate the placement of air bottle, be effectively protected air bottle.
By setting protection rubber cushion in the arc groove of lower support base and upper limit seat, so as to avoid lower support base,
Direct hard contact between upper limit seat and air bottle, improves the protective effect to air bottle;Likewise, on tie down screw top
The protection gum cover of one end suit one of tight air bottle, also for direct hard contact between tie down screw and air bottle is avoided, is carried
The high protective effect to air bottle.
